MARLANGO'S
'IMPERFECTION' GOES WORLDWIDE
Por Howell Llewellyn. Publicado
en Billboard el 29 de julio de 2006.
Leonor
Watling is best-known outside her
native Spain as the star of such
movies as Pedro Almodóvar's
"Talk to Her". She may
soon be known for hr music now that
"Automatic Imperfection",
the second album by Watling's jazz-pop
ensemble marlango, is receiving
a global release through Universal
Classics & Jazz. Th album went
gold (50.000 units) after it was
first issued in Spain in September
2005 by Madrid indie label Subterfuge
Records and is lcensed for international
distribution to Universal Music
Spain.
In May, marlango was signed directly
to Universal Music Spain. During
July, Universal Classics & Jazz
began rereleasing the album in Europe,
Latin America, japan, Singapore
and Australia on Emarcy/Verve. The
reissue carries six bonus tracks
and a DVD of a live Barcelona performance.
Verve is expected to handle the
album in the United Statets.
Watling, whose mother was British
writes the act's English-language
lyrics. She fronts a trio that includes
Alejandro Pelayo (piano) and Oscar
Ybarra (trumpet/flugelhorn), augmented
in the studio by fiv other musicians
for "Automatic Imperfection".
"We are very satisfied with
Marlango's first international steps",
Universal Music Spain local product
manager Maya Nieto says. The act
is booked woldwide through RLM International
and published by Warner/Chappell/Pizza
Pop.
